"Caring at all times "

About: Queen Elizabeth Hospital Birmingham

A huge thank you to the teenage cancer services. Sadly the battle with cancer was a tough 19 month journey, and my sibling passed away on 22/4/2021.

There was some highs and lows. The staff on ward 622 were amazing. The end of life care we received was, with such dignity, kindness and respect. We were kept well informed by the nurses and doctors at all times. Even when the situation became quite challenging the team were assertive and respectful to us all.

We are extremely grateful for the loving care we have had from the cancer team and the aftercare too.

Keep doing what you do and thank you once again.
